Ver Mensaje Individual
  #9 (permalink)  
Antiguo 12/02/2012, 19:29
Avatar de Ribon
Ribon
 
Fecha de Ingreso: septiembre-2010
Ubicación: El firmamento
Mensajes: 487
Antigüedad: 13 años, 7 meses
Puntos: 91
Respuesta: Como conseguir que count me devuelva 0 si el directorio esta vacío??

Ojo, si te devuelve FALSE es porque hay un error

Cita:
Iniciado por php.net
Return Values

Returns an array containing the matched files/directories, an empty array if no file matched or FALSE on error.
Nunca he usado GLOB pero tal vez haya un error en el patrón.
de todas formas puedes poner esta condición que encontré mismo en la página de PHP

Código PHP:
Ver original
  1. $archivos = glob($directory."/{*.jpg,*.gif,*.png}",GLOB_BRACE);
  2.  
  3. if(is_array($archivos) && count($archivos) > 0){
  4.    ....
  5. }

creo que es la mejor solución :D!

fuente: http://www.php.net/manual/en/function.glob.php#103561

saludos.
__________________
Utilice el Highlight para mostrar código, mis ojos se lo agradecerán :)
qué es esto? :O -> http://i48.tinypic.com/5x3kzs.png
Ya sabes :)

Última edición por Ribon; 12/02/2012 a las 19:37